Girls Take Victory over Macon's Tattnall Square
by Stephen Van Gorp

The Lady Knights soccer had a huge victory over Tattnall Square on Tuesday. The Macon team came out with a strong first attack by scoring its first goal within the first two minutes of the game. However, the girls didn’t lose heart but kept on pushing through to score the next four goals before Tattnall scored their second one to finish the score at 4-2. Alex Russ-Stefancic scored three of the four goals with assists by Kelsey Howard and Haylee Summerlin. Also Kelsey scored on goal that was assisted by Erin Summerlin. This game marked the team’s first season game of starting out behind but having to work their way back to the top. It not only built them up to realize the type of competition that they are going to have to prepare for in later games, but also has given them encouragement for the rest of the season and high hopes for the state tournament.
